首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

每次加载表单时保持禁用按钮

是一种常见的前端开发技术,用于在用户提交表单之前禁用提交按钮,以防止用户重复提交或在表单尚未完全加载时进行提交操作。

这种技术的实现方式可以通过以下步骤来完成:

  1. 在HTML表单中,为提交按钮添加一个初始状态为禁用的属性。例如,可以使用disabled属性来禁用按钮:<button type="submit" disabled>提交</button>
  2. 在页面加载完成后,使用JavaScript代码来启用提交按钮。可以通过在页面的DOMContentLoaded事件中添加以下代码来实现:document.addEventListener('DOMContentLoaded', function() { document.querySelector('button[type="submit"]').removeAttribute('disabled'); });。这段代码会在页面加载完成后自动执行,将提交按钮的disabled属性移除,从而启用按钮。

通过每次加载表单时保持禁用按钮,可以有效地防止用户重复提交表单或在表单尚未完全加载时进行提交操作,提升用户体验和数据的完整性。

在腾讯云的产品中,可以使用腾讯云的云服务器(CVM)来部署前端代码和后端服务,使用腾讯云的对象存储(COS)来存储表单数据,使用腾讯云的云函数(SCF)来处理表单提交的后端逻辑。此外,腾讯云还提供了丰富的网络安全产品,如云防火墙(CFW)和Web应用防火墙(WAF),用于保护表单数据的安全性。

更多关于腾讯云产品的详细信息和介绍,可以访问腾讯云官方网站:腾讯云

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• ajax提交等待服务器响应友好提示信息的实现

    众所周知,在客户端向服务器发送AJAX请求时,会有一个等待服务器响应的过程,在网络环境好而且服务器负荷小的时候,业务逻辑不大太复杂的请求可能一下子就处理完并返回响应结果了,但当网络环境不理想或请求涉及到大量的运算时,服务器响应的时间或许就会比较漫长了,特别对于正在操作,正期待操作结果的用户来说,这段等待时候是无比的漫长,如果你没有过这样的操作体验,你回想一下约会时别人迟到的时候或有急事出门时在公交站苦苦等车的滋味,相信你就能感同身受了,而让用户忍受如此煎熬,对于强调用户体验的Web2.0时代,是大忌,是追求“为用户创造价值,让用户享受电子商务所带来的方便快捷”为宗旨的我所不能接受的。虽然,我不能改变客观环境因素带来的长响应时间,但我可以告诉用户系统正在做什么,让他们感受到,系统很在乎他们的感受,并愿意亲切地和他们交流的,而不是传统的软件那样,死板、霸道、冷冰冰的,好了,不多说大道理了,看看我的做法吧。

    03
    领券